Responsibilities

* Provide 1:1 and small-group support to SEN students.
* Implement and track progress against Individualised Education Plans (IEPs/EHCPs).
* Adapt learning materials and classroom activities under teacher guidance.
* Support student's social, emotional, and behavioural needs.
* Observe, record, and report on student progress to the teacher.
* Maintain a safe, positive, and inclusive classroom environment.


Preferred Skills

* Proven experience with a range of SEN (e.g., Autism, ADHD, SpLD).
* Strong understanding of safeguarding procedures and SEN strategies.
* Effective de-escalation, communication, and interpersonal abilities.
* Relevant TA or Special Education qualification is desirable.
* A full, clean driving licence.


Personal Attributes

* Be comfortable and confident in managing challenging behaviours.
* Ability to engage with, and build rapport with the students.
* Be creative, proactive and flexible in their supporting style.
* Have experience with SEND or knowledge learning difficulties.
* Patient, empathetic, and resilient.
